Python port of SymSpell: 1 million times faster spelling correction & fuzzy search through Symmetric Delete spelling correction algorithm
-
Updated
Mar 21, 2024 - Python
Python port of SymSpell: 1 million times faster spelling correction & fuzzy search through Symmetric Delete spelling correction algorithm
Fuzzy string matching, grouping, and evaluation.
Python library for computing edit distance between arbitrary Python sequences.
📐 Hidden alignment conditional random field for classifying string pairs.
An efficient data structure for fast string similarity searches
Custom TensorFlow2 implementations of forward and backward computation of soft-DTW algorithm in batch mode.
Fast edit distance Python extension written in Cython/C++. Supports Levenshtein distance and Damerau Optimal String Alignment (OSA) distance.
To evaluate machine translation, they use several methods, some of which we fully implemented
Implementation of the Optimal Completion Distillation for Sequence Labeling
Efficient String Comparison Functions and Fuzzy String Matching
Text Matching Based on LCQMC: A Large-scale Chinese Question Matching Corpus
Compilation of Natural Language Processing (NLP) codes. BONUS: Link to Information Retrieval (IR) codes compilation. (checkout the readme)
"Music Plagiarism Detection via Bipartite Graph Matching"
Deduplicate data using fuzzy and deterministic matching rules.
Perform visual music-based fugal analysis using subjects, countersubjects, and their transformations.
Trie implementation for approximate string matching.
CRF Edit Distance
Global NIPS Paper Implementation Challenge - An Automated System for Essay Scoring of Online Exams in Arabic based on Stemming Techniques and Levenshtein Edit Operations
Add a description, image, and links to the edit-distance topic page so that developers can more easily learn about it.
To associate your repository with the edit-distance topic, visit your repo's landing page and select "manage topics."